Currently, it is pretty easy to either test a system on for example US stocks incl. foreign primaries. The same goes for Europe incl. foreign primaries and Canada incl foreign primaries.
However, I cannot find a way to test a system on the aggregated universe of US stockcs incl. foreign primary + Europe incl. foreign primary + Canada incl. foreign primary.
Is there a way to do this or can I only use the ‘Easy to Trade North Atlantic’ universe to get an aggregate version?
The North Atlantic universe includes all the stocks we have EXCEPT those whose primary listings are outside North American and Europe (i.e. in Latin America, Asia, Eurasia, Africa, and the Middle East). That’s the closest you can get to an “aggregated universe.” These stocks are mostly ADRs in our system and only appear in the United States incl. foreign primaries and the United States (all listed stocks) universes (and their subsets).
